W10364988 Whirlpool Valve

W10364988 Whirlpool Valve⁣ is a‍ replacement⁣ valve assembly used in Whirlpool-brand appliances to control the flow of water within the⁣ machine. It is a compact ⁢electromechanical valve-typically a solenoid-actuated component with inlet and outlet ports, internal seals or diaphragms, and an electrical connector-that opens and closes under command from the appliance‌ control electronics ​to allow or stop water flow.

Inside an appliance,this valve interfaces ⁣between‌ the external water supply ‍and​ the device’s internal hydraulic⁣ and control systems. It receives electrical signals from the main control board or timer to modulate fill cycles, and it works in concert‌ with inlet hoses, pressure ⁣sensors or water-level‌ switches, pumps and drain path components. Proper⁤ operation of the ⁤valve​ is essential for accurate fill volumes, ⁤prevention of‍ overfilling or leaks, and coordinated timing of wash ⁣and rinse cycles; failures can present as no-fill, continuous-fill, leaks, or erratic cycle behavior.

Function and Operational Role of the⁤ Dishwasher Water Inlet Valve in Whirlpool Systems

The W10364988 Whirlpool Valve is the solenoid-operated water inlet ​valve that meters mains water into the dishwasher under control-board command. it uses one or more electrically driven diaphragms and plunger assemblies to open⁣ a passage from the household supply to the tub for a defined interval; that timed opening, combined with inlet pressure, determines fill volume.The valve also provides a shutoff ‍sealing ⁤function to prevent supply leaks when ⁢the appliance is idle. Technicians should verify⁣ that the⁣ replacement valve matches the original port layout, mounting points, and electrical connector to​ ensure‍ hydraulic and electrical compatibility with‌ the⁢ specific Whirlpool model.

Operational behavior and ⁣practical diagnostics focus on the ‌valve’s interaction with⁣ the control electronics and the supply ⁤conditions. Typical fault​ modes include a failed coil (no actuation),stuck ‍or leaking seat (continuous or slow fill),and restricted flow from a clogged inlet ‌screen or low household pressure. A practical troubleshooting approach is to confirm the control board applies voltage during ‌the fill interval, measure coil resistance for an ​open or shorted winding, and inspect the inlet screen and seat for debris. When replacing the valve, retain OEM part matching and verify that installation seals and hose connections⁤ meet the dishwasher’s service specifications ‍to prevent flow or leak issues.

  • No fill during fill cycle; check for ​coil voltage and inlet shutoff.
  • Continuous fill or slow drain; inspect valve seat and inlet screen for debris or wear.
  • Intermittent operation; test coil resistance and connector integrity.
  • When replacing, match port‌ configuration, mounting, and electrical connector to the original ​part.

How the W10364988 Whirlpool Valve Works Inside the Appliance: Internal Mechanisms and ‌Electrical Interface

The W10364988 Whirlpool Valve is a solenoid-actuated water control element that regulates water flow by moving an internal plunger or diaphragm against a ​valve seat to⁤ open or close specific inlet ports. Internally, the‌ assembly combines a magnetic coil, a ferrous plunger or poppet, return spring,⁤ and molded flow⁣ passages;​ when the coil receives an electrical command​ the plunger retracts, ​allowing pressurized water to pass through designated channels while built-in check features and sealing surfaces prevent backflow and leakage. Fit and compatibility depend on the valve body geometry,⁢ port spacing and mounting points, and the electrical connector type, so replacements must match the appliance model’s inlet manifold and bracket locations​ to‍ avoid misalignment, stress on hoses, or ⁢improper sealing during operation.

The electrical interface on the W10364988 Whirlpool Valve is a ⁤simple two- or multi‑wire solenoid connection driven ​by ⁣the appliance control board; the board supplies ⁣the coil with either a steady or pulsed voltage profile depending on how the machine modulates fill rates. Common diagnostic checks include verifying ⁤coil continuity with a multimeter,‍ confirming the control board applies ‍the expected​ voltage when a fill is requested, and ⁢observing an audible click and visible flow when the valve is energized.Typical failure modes are ‌coil open-circuit,mechanical⁣ sticking of the⁢ plunger from debris or mineral scale,and seal degradation that leads to ​partial flow or leakage; always isolate mains power before⁤ disconnecting or bench-testing the valve and consult⁢ the service manual for‍ the correct coil voltage and resistance specifications.

  • Common symptoms: no fill (coil open), ‍continuous fill (stuck or leaking seat), intermittent operation (control⁢ or wiring fault).
  • Installation note: match‌ port layout and connector type to the appliance model to ensure mechanical and ‌electrical compatibility.
  • Diagnostics: continuity check,applied voltage​ verification at command,and inspection ⁣for ⁢debris ​or seal⁣ wear.

Common Failure Symptoms and Diagnostic Indicators of Valve Malfunctions

The W10364988 Whirlpool Valve functions as the water inlet control for ⁢compatible Whirlpool appliances, using a solenoid-actuated plunger and elastomeric seat ⁤to open and close the flow path under ⁣command from the​ appliance controller. Proper⁣ operation depends on both the electrical subsystem (coil continuity, correct control voltage and signal timing from the control board, and ⁤intact wiring/connectors) and ​the mechanical⁤ subsystem (unobstructed inlet screen, free-moving plunger/diaphragm,⁢ and intact seals). Compatibility considerations-such as correct mounting ⁣orientation, inlet fitting size, and matching valve actuation specifications-effect behavior after replacement; a valve that is electrically correct but mechanically incompatible can produce slow‌ fill, leaks, or improper⁢ fill ‌volumes under normal supply pressure.

Technically, failed valves present a predictable⁤ set of symptoms that map to specific diagnostic checks useful to technicians and engineers.​ Use a multimeter to verify coil continuity and to‌ check for correct control voltage during a fill cycle, visually inspect the inlet screen and plunger for mineral deposits or debris, and pressure-test⁣ the supply. Common observable symptoms include:

  • No fill at⁢ all (valve fails to open – check for open coil, absent control voltage, or blocked inlet ‍screen).
  • Continuous ‍fill or overflow (valve stuck open or seat failure – inspect diaphragm/seal and mechanical obstruction).
  • Slow or restricted⁢ fill (partial obstruction, low ⁣supply pressure, or partially seized plunger).
  • Audible humming without flow (coil energized but plunger not moving​ – mechanical​ seizure or collapsed seat).
  • Visible leak beneath the appliance (cracked valve body,loose​ fittings,or degraded seals).

Q&A

What is the W10364988 valve ‌and what does it do?

The‌ W10364988 is a replacement valve ⁤assembly used on certain Whirlpool-family appliances to control the flow of water. In appliances it commonly functions as ⁢a solenoid-operated inlet/diverter that opens and closes to allow water into the appliance (for fill cycles,ice makers,dispensers,etc.).‌ exact function and ⁣mounting location depend on the appliance model,so always confirm fit by cross-referencing your ‌appliance⁤ model number with‌ the parts list.

How do I know if the W10364988 valve is failing?

Typical symptoms of a failing inlet/solenoid valve include: ‍no water or reduced water into the appliance, overly long or continuous fill, intermittent filling, leaks at the valve, unusual clicking ‌or humming, and related error codes on the control panel. Some symptoms can also be caused by clogged strainers, kinked supply ‌lines, or a‌ faulty control board, so inspect those first.

How can I test‌ the W10364988 ​valve to​ see if it is bad?

Basic tests:⁣ (1) Disconnect power‍ and water‌ before servicing. (2) Visually inspect ⁢the valve body, fittings and inlet strainer/screen for debris or damage. (3) With the valve removed ⁢or accessible, check ⁣coil continuity using a multimeter – a good coil will show continuity; an open coil indicates failure. (4) While the appliance ⁣is running a fill cycle,‌ measure voltage at the valve connector to confirm the‍ control is sending the correct operating voltage. (5) If safe and you know‍ the correct operating ⁣voltage, ⁤a momentary⁣ submission of the correct voltage to the coil (using⁣ insulated leads) should​ actuate the ‍valve – do‍ this only if you are qualified. If the coil has continuity and⁤ control voltage⁣ is present but the valve ⁣doesn’t open, ⁢the valve is likely mechanically stuck or failed ⁤and should be replaced.

Can the W10364988 valve be repaired or should it be replaced?

most of these valves are replaced rather ‍than rebuilt. you can frequently enough clean an inlet screen/strainer or remove mineral buildup that restricts flow, but‍ internal wear, failed solenoid windings, or damaged seals typically require a full replacement. Replacing the​ valve⁤ assembly is usually the ‍fastest and most reliable fix.

What are the ⁤safe steps to replace the W10364988 valve?

Basic replacement steps: 1) Unplug the appliance and shut off ⁣the water supply. 2) Relieve any residual pressure by running a short cycle‍ or opening a dispenser. 3) Access the valve (consult the service manual ​for ​your model). 4) Photograph or label electrical connectors, then disconnect them. 5) disconnect water lines (have⁢ a ‍towel/bucket ready). 6) Remove mounting screws and remove the old valve. 7) Install the new valve, using the same​ orientation and‍ new gaskets/seals⁢ if⁣ provided. ‍8) Reattach water lines and electrical ⁤connectors, restore water and power, then​ test for correct operation and leaks. If you’re not⁢ pleasant with electrical or ⁢plumbing work,​ hire‌ a qualified technician.

Do I need special tools or parts to install the W10364988⁤ valve?

No specialized tools are usually required. Common hand tools (screwdrivers, pliers, adjustable wrench), a multimeter for electrical checks, towels/bucket to catch water, and possibly ‌replacement hose clamps or thread sealant are typically all that’s needed. Use only the correct replacement gaskets/seals supplied with ​the part or OEM ​replacements to prevent ‍leaks.

How do I verify that W10364988 is ⁣the correct replacement for my appliance?

Verify by using your appliance’s full⁣ model number and ‌checking the official Whirlpool parts lookup, the parts list in the service manual,⁤ or a trusted parts distributor’s compatibility lookup. Compare the physical appearance, mounting points, electrical connector type, inlet/outlet sizes and orientation. If in ⁤doubt, provide your appliance ‍model number⁢ to a‍ Whirlpool parts dealer or authorized service tech for confirmation.
